Additional symptoms are included below aside from the ones mentioned above: a sore tongue constipation difficulty thinking and remembering dementia fatigue heart palpitations infertility low appetite mood changes numbness and tingling sensation in the hands and feet pale skin weight loss Other conditions that may affect vitamin B12 release or absorption are related to the gastrointestinal tract, including the following: celiac disease Crohns disease fish tapeworm infestation bowel or pancreatic cancer folic acid deficiency overgrowth of bacteria in the small intestine pernicious anemia (can lead to gastric atrophy or stomach damage) Moreover, those who have undergone gastrointestinal surgery, including weight loss surgery, may have fewer cells necessary to secrete stomach acid and intrinsic factors

Another class of gastric acid inhibitors known as histamine 2 (H 2 )-receptor antagonists (e.g., cimetidine, famotidine, and ranitidine), often used to treat peptic ulcer disease, has also been found to decrease the absorption of vitamin B 12 from food
